is an illustrated essay by writer Carmen G. de la Cueva and illustrator Ana Jarén that reconstructs the female literary genealogy of 20th-century Spain. Published by Lumen in February 2023, the book functions as both a historical recovery and a personal reflection on how friendship and sorority have sustained women's creative lives.
